Skip to content

MODELIX-829 Split INode interface into multiple interfaces #3021

MODELIX-829 Split INode interface into multiple interfaces

MODELIX-829 Split INode interface into multiple interfaces #3021

Triggered via pull request February 3, 2025 12:08
Status Success
Total duration 2m 14s
Artifacts

linting.yml

on: pull_request
pre-commit
35s
pre-commit
openapi-linting
41s
openapi-linting
openapi-breaking-changes
15s
openapi-breaking-changes
Fit to window
Zoom out
Zoom in

Annotations

108 warnings
operation-description: model-server-openapi/specifications/model-server-operative.yaml#L23
Operation "description" must be present and non-empty string.
operation-description: model-server-openapi/specifications/model-server-v2.yaml#L23
Operation "description" must be present and non-empty string.
info-contact: model-server-openapi/specifications/model-server-v2.yaml#L11
Info object must have "contact" object.
info-contact: model-server-openapi/specifications/model-server-operative.yaml#L12
Info object must have "contact" object.
info-contact: model-server-openapi/specifications/model-server-v1.yaml#L11
Info object must have "contact" object.
operation-tag-defined: model-server-openapi/specifications/model-server-operative.yaml#L26
Operation tags must be defined in global tags.
operation-description: model-server-openapi/specifications/model-server-v2.yaml#L34
Operation "description" must be present and non-empty string.
operation-description: model-server-openapi/specifications/model-server-v2.yaml#L54
Operation "description" must be present and non-empty string.
operation-description: model-server-openapi/specifications/model-server-v2.yaml#L64
Operation "description" must be present and non-empty string.
operation-description: model-server-openapi/specifications/model-server-operative.yaml#L32
Operation "description" must be present and non-empty string.
operation-tag-defined: model-server-openapi/specifications/model-server-v1.yaml#L51
Operation tags must be defined in global tags.
operation-tag-defined: model-server-openapi/specifications/model-server-operative.yaml#L49
Operation tags must be defined in global tags.
operation-description: model-server-openapi/specifications/model-server-v1.yaml#L49
Operation "description" must be present and non-empty string.
must-use-lowercase-with-hypens-for-path-segements: model-server-openapi/specifications/model-server-v1.yaml#L91
Path segments have to be lowercase separate words with hyphens
operation-description: model-server-openapi/specifications/model-server-operative.yaml#L43
Operation "description" must be present and non-empty string.
operation-tag-defined: model-server-openapi/specifications/model-server-v1.yaml#L94
Operation tags must be defined in global tags.
operation-description: model-server-openapi/specifications/model-server-v2.yaml#L84
Operation "description" must be present and non-empty string.
must-use-lowercase-with-hypens-for-path-segements: model-server-openapi/specifications/model-server-v1.yaml#L69
Path segments have to be lowercase separate words with hyphens
operation-tag-defined: model-server-openapi/specifications/model-server-v1.yaml#L32
Operation tags must be defined in global tags.
operation-tag-defined: model-server-openapi/specifications/model-server-v1.yaml#L72
Operation tags must be defined in global tags.
should-prefer-standard-media-type-names: model-server-openapi/specifications/model-server-operative.yaml#L63
Custom media types should only be used for versioning
operation-tag-defined: model-server-openapi/specifications/model-server-v1.yaml#L23
Operation tags must be defined in global tags.
operation-description: model-server-openapi/specifications/model-server-v2.yaml#L44
Operation "description" must be present and non-empty string.
operation-description: model-server-openapi/specifications/model-server-v2.yaml#L100
Operation "description" must be present and non-empty string.
must-use-lowercase-with-hypens-for-path-segements: model-server-openapi/specifications/model-server-v2.yaml#L83
Path segments have to be lowercase separate words with hyphens
must-use-lowercase-with-hypens-for-path-segements: model-server-openapi/specifications/model-server-v1.yaml#L82
Path segments have to be lowercase separate words with hyphens
operation-description: model-server-openapi/specifications/model-server-v1.yaml#L83
Operation "description" must be present and non-empty string.
operation-tag-defined: model-server-openapi/specifications/model-server-operative.yaml#L35
Operation tags must be defined in global tags.
operation-tag-defined: model-server-openapi/specifications/model-server-v1.yaml#L85
Operation tags must be defined in global tags.
operation-tag-defined: model-server-openapi/specifications/model-server-v1.yaml#L156
Operation tags must be defined in global tags.
operation-description: model-server-openapi/specifications/model-server-v1.yaml#L92
Operation "description" must be present and non-empty string.
operation-description: model-server-openapi/specifications/model-server-v1.yaml#L30
Operation "description" must be present and non-empty string.
operation-tag-defined: model-server-openapi/specifications/model-server-v1.yaml#L109
Operation tags must be defined in global tags.
operation-description: model-server-openapi/specifications/model-server-v1.yaml#L133
Operation "description" must be present and non-empty string.
operation-description: model-server-openapi/specifications/model-server-v2.yaml#L116
Operation "description" must be present and non-empty string.
should-prefer-standard-media-type-names: model-server-openapi/specifications/model-server-v2.yaml#L179
Custom media types should only be used for versioning
operation-tag-defined: model-server-openapi/specifications/model-server-v1.yaml#L135
Operation tags must be defined in global tags.
operation-description: model-server-openapi/specifications/model-server-v1.yaml#L70
Operation "description" must be present and non-empty string.
operation-description: model-server-openapi/specifications/model-server-v2.yaml#L244
Operation "description" must be present and non-empty string.
operation-description: model-server-openapi/specifications/model-server-v1.yaml#L107
Operation "description" must be present and non-empty string.
must-use-lowercase-with-hypens-for-path-segements: model-server-openapi/specifications/model-server-v1.yaml#L153
Path segments have to be lowercase separate words with hyphens
should-prefer-standard-media-type-names: model-server-openapi/specifications/model-server-v2.yaml#L185
Custom media types should only be used for versioning
operation-description: model-server-openapi/specifications/model-server-v2.yaml#L138
Operation "description" must be present and non-empty string.
should-prefer-standard-media-type-names: model-server-openapi/specifications/model-server-v1.yaml#L173
Custom media types should only be used for versioning
operation-description: model-server-openapi/specifications/model-server-v2.yaml#L190
Operation "description" must be present and non-empty string.
must-use-lowercase-with-hypens-for-path-segements: model-server-openapi/specifications/model-server-v2.yaml#L273
Path segments have to be lowercase separate words with hyphens
operation-description: model-server-openapi/specifications/model-server-v1.yaml#L20
Operation "description" must be present and non-empty string.
should-prefer-standard-media-type-names: model-server-openapi/specifications/model-server-v2.yaml#L176
Custom media types should only be used for versioning
operation-description: model-server-openapi/specifications/model-server-v2.yaml#L274
Operation "description" must be present and non-empty string.
operation-description: model-server-openapi/specifications/model-server-v2.yaml#L332
Operation "description" must be present and non-empty string.
operation-description: model-server-openapi/specifications/model-server-v1.yaml#L154
Operation "description" must be present and non-empty string.
operation-description: model-server-openapi/specifications/model-server-v2.yaml#L442
Operation "description" must be present and non-empty string.
operation-description: model-server-openapi/specifications/model-server-v2.yaml#L309
Operation "description" must be present and non-empty string.
oas3-unused-component: model-server-openapi/specifications/model-server-v1.yaml#L183
Potentially unused component has been detected.
should-use-well-understood-http-status-codes: model-server-openapi/specifications/model-server-v2.yaml#L375
204 is not a well-understood HTTP status code for POST
operation-description: model-server-openapi/specifications/model-server-v2.yaml#L364
Operation "description" must be present and non-empty string.
should-prefer-standard-media-type-names: model-server-openapi/specifications/model-server-v2.yaml#L412
Custom media types should only be used for versioning
should-prefer-standard-media-type-names: model-server-openapi/specifications/model-server-v2.yaml#L378
Custom media types should only be used for versioning
operation-description: model-server-openapi/specifications/model-server-v2.yaml#L418
Operation "description" must be present and non-empty string.
operation-description: model-server-openapi/specifications/model-server-v2.yaml#L386
Operation "description" must be present and non-empty string.
operation-description: model-server-openapi/specifications/model-server-v2.yaml#L221
Operation "description" must be present and non-empty string.
should-prefer-standard-media-type-names: model-server-openapi/specifications/model-server-v2.yaml#L470
Custom media types should only be used for versioning
should-prefer-standard-media-type-names: model-server-openapi/specifications/model-server-v2.yaml#L513
Custom media types should only be used for versioning
oas3-unused-component: model-server-openapi/specifications/model-server-v2.yaml#L473
Potentially unused component has been detected.
oas3-unused-component: model-server-openapi/specifications/model-server-v2.yaml#L486
Potentially unused component has been detected.
must-use-standard-http-status-codes: model-server-openapi/specifications/model-server-v2.yaml#L510
ModelQlQueryExecutionFailed is not a standardized response code
should-prefer-standard-media-type-names: model-server-openapi/specifications/model-server-v2.yaml#L539
Custom media types should only be used for versioning
oas3-unused-component: model-server-openapi/specifications/model-server-v2.yaml#L544
Potentially unused component has been detected.
must-use-problem-json-for-errors: model-server-openapi/specifications/model-server-v2.yaml#L512
Error response must be application/problem+json
should-prefer-standard-media-type-names: model-server-openapi/specifications/model-server-v2.yaml#L530
Custom media types should only be used for versioning
should-prefer-standard-media-type-names: model-server-openapi/specifications/model-server-v2.yaml#L533
Custom media types should only be used for versioning
pre-commit
The `python-version` input is not set. The version of Python currently in `PATH` will be used.
can handle random changes[js, browser] (org.modelix.model.sync.bulk.ModelImporterTest) failed: org.modelix.model.sync.bulk.ModelImporterTest#L0
bulk-model-sync-lib/build/test-results/jsBrowserTest/TEST-org.modelix.model.sync.bulk.ModelImporterTest.xml [took 1m 2s]